Why UAE Gyms Need Dedicated Gym Management Software
Running a gym in the UAE comes with demands that generic scheduling or accounting tools just weren't built for.
VAT-ready billing. Every membership, class pack, and PT package needs a proper tax invoice. That invoice should generate automatically — not get rebuilt by hand in Excel every month. This is one of the most important things to check before you choose a platform.
A WhatsApp-first member base. WhatsApp is how UAE businesses and customers talk to each other. That makes automatic renewal reminders, booking confirmations, and payment alerts especially useful.
A diverse, often short-term member base. The UAE has a large expat population. Members move for work, stay for a season, or settle long-term. Your software needs membership plans, freezes, and cancellations flexible enough to handle all three.
Many ways to pay. UAE members expect to pay however suits them — local debit cards, digital wallets, Apple Pay, or international cards. "Pay at the counter only" isn't good enough anymore.
Multiple locations. Many of the UAE's fastest-growing gym brands are expanding across Dubai Marina, Business Bay, Abu Dhabi, and Sharjah at the same time. They need one dashboard to see how every branch is doing — not five separate logins.
A gym software platform built for the UAE turns these headaches into automatic background tasks.
What the Best Gym Software in the UAE Should Include
1. Membership & Plan Management
Monthly, quarterly, annual, corporate, and family memberships should renew, pause, and expire on their own — no manual tracking needed. Look for flexible freeze, pause, and cancellation options, especially if many of your members travel often or stay only part of the year.
2. WhatsApp Automation
The right platform sends renewal reminders, class confirmations, payment receipts, and win-back messages straight to WhatsApp. Your front desk team shouldn't have to lift a finger.
3. VAT-Ready Billing & Multiple Payment Options
Your software should create compliant tax invoices automatically. It should also support however your members like to pay — cards, digital wallets, bank transfers, cash — all tracked in one place.
4. Class & Session Booking
Members should be able to book classes, PT sessions, or court time anytime, from their phone. Automated waitlists should fill any last-minute cancellations, so classes don't run half-empty.
5. Multi-Branch & Franchise Reporting
If you run more than one location — or plan to — you need one view across all of them. That means combined revenue, per-branch profit and loss, and central control over staff and members.
6. AI-Driven Retention Insights
Modern platforms can spot members who are likely to cancel, weeks before they actually do. They look at attendance drop-off and payment patterns. That gives you time to win them back. This matters a lot in a market as competitive as the UAE's.
7. Access Control & POS
Turnstile or QR/RFID entry removes the need for manual check-ins at the front desk. A built-in retail POS lets you sell supplements, apparel, and drinks without a separate till system.

How to Choose the Right Gym Software for Your UAE Business
Before you commit to a platform, ask these questions:
● Does it handle VAT invoicing on its own, or will your accountant still be fixing exports every month?
● Is WhatsApp automation built in, or is it a separate paid add-on?
● Can it grow with you to multiple branches, without forcing you onto a pricier plan later?
● How long does setup and data migration take? Switching software shouldn't mean weeks of downtime or lost member records.
● Does it warn you about members likely to cancel, or only report the loss after they're already gone?
● What does support look like once you're live — a help desk ticket queue, or a real onboarding team?
